About company
ReUp - Information page for ReUp (A software company based in London, UK). Email: hi@reup.london ©2022 ReUp
- US 1115 east pike street
- hi@reup.london
- +442032907639
- reup.tech
- Not verified company
ReUp - Information page for ReUp (A software company based in London, UK). Email: hi@reup.london ©2022 ReUp